#a2644a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a2644a is composed of 63.5% red, 39.2%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.3% magenta, 54.3%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 17.7 degrees, a saturation of 37.3% and a lightness of 46.3%. #a2644a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c894 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#a2644a color description : Dark moderate orange.

#a2644a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a2644a has RGB values of R:162, G:100,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.54,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10642506.

Shades and Tints of #a2644a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f9f4f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a2644a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e736e is the less saturated color, while #eb4601 is the most saturated one.
